Struggling with Inconsistent Sales? Don’t fix your Sales Team!
If youโre a business owner, entrepreneur, CEO, or leader of a team, youโve probably had this moment many times – sales drop, panic sets in, and the first instinct is to pressure the team. More check-ins. More targets. More motivation. Just more noise!
Hereโs the reality – inconsistent sales arenโt usually a people problem. Theyโre a system problem.
When sales dip, stop blaming the Team
Itโs easy to fall into the trap of thinking your sales team isnโt working hard enough. However, most of the time, theyโre working extremely hard. The problem is theyโre working without a system that supports their consistent success.
Instead of looking at your team, look at whatโs missing from your sales structure:
- Are there clear daily metrics in place?
- Is there a proven sales playbook that everyone is following?
- Is real-time feedback part of your sales teams culture?
- Do you know where in your sales process, deals are falling apart?
If the answer to any of these is โno,โ thatโs your starting point.
Sales systems win, motivation doesnโt
You donโt need another team meeting filled with ‘rah-rah’ & ‘let’s go get them’ energy. That kind of motivation doesnโt move the needle over the long-term. What moves the needle, is strong mechanics, clear steps and measurable metrics that your team can follow every single day.
Think of your sales process like a high-performance machine. Every moving part needs to be aligned, checked, and maintained. When one part fails, the whole machine slows down, or breaks.
Ask better questions, get better sales results
Step off the sidelines and get back into the game. Look at your sales process like a player on the field and ask:
- What part of the sales process is being skipped, missed, or rushed?
- Do we even have a proper, documented process?
- Where exactly are we losing the deal, and why?
Once youโve got the answers, build the system that fixes the leaks.
The Bottom Line
Inconsistent sales are not a sign that your people arenโt good enough, theyโre a sign your process isnโt strong enough.
When you fix the sales system, you remove the guesswork, the frustration and the inconsistency. When this happens, your team performs better, your revenue grows and you get back to leading, instead of constantly firefighting.
